Chemical Property of (1-Methylcyclohexanyl)methyl-4-nitrophenyl Ether Edit
Chemical Property:
  • Melting Point:59-60°C 
  • Boiling Point:372.1±15.0 °C(Predicted) 
  • PSA:55.05000 
  • Density:1.102±0.06 g/cm3(Predicted) 
  • LogP:4.46720 
  • Storage Temp.:Amber Vial, -20°C Freezer 
  • Solubility.:Chloroform (Slightly), Ethyl Acetate (Slightly) 
  • XLogP3:4.5
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:3
  • Rotatable Bond Count:3
  • Exact Mass:249.13649347
  • Heavy Atom Count:18
  • Complexity:273
